Listening Books is a UK charity providing nearly 10,000 fantastic audiobooks on three easily accessible formats: downloads, internet streaming and MP3 CDs.

We also give members who choose our downloading and streaming memberships access to thousands of newspapers and magazines through our partner service, PressReader.

Our service is available to anyone who has a disability or illness which makes it difficult to hold a book, turn its pages, or read in the usual way. We cater for both adults and children. We provide audiobooks for leisure to all age groups as well as supporting the National Curriculum from Key Stage 2 to A-Level. We have over 100,000 members across the UK and all of our titles are either commercially sourced or recorded in our own digital studios.

We provide access to the wonderful world of books for thousands of people in hospices, hospitals, nursing homes and schools as well as in their own homes. We also participate in several schemes to support children in care
